CEM Playbook tab
The Playbook tab in Critical Event Management (CEM) provides an agent a step-by-step guide for managing critical events. It tracks tasks across different phases and confirms that all necessary actions are completed.
A playbook serves as a starting point for customers to set up processes tailored to their specific needs.
The Playbook tab has the following phases:
- In the Triage Playbook you can:
- Review the incoming submission to identify and confirm the critical event.
- Connect the critical event to an existing parent record if it’s directly related or part of a larger situation.
- Assign the critical event to appropriate responders to promote timely action.
- In the Generic Playbook you can:
- Evaluate the details of the critical event to determine the necessary actions.
- Monitor that all event details are accurate and current.
- Coordinate communications with responders and affected individuals, send initial updates and follow-ups as needed.
- Confirm the statuses of all potentially impacted individuals to account for everyone.
- Create incident records if needed or review the list of incidents generated.
